Researchers find eggs help with weight

Louisiana State University researchers are calling eggs the breakfast of champions.

They found eating two whole eggs in the morning helped dieters lose 65 percent more weight than those who ate a bagel with cream cheese.

Both had the same amount of calories, but participants who ate the eggs, yolk and all, felt less hungry, more energy and were less likely to snack unnecessarily.
